EGI-JRA1 Tools IPv6 Readiness
Accounting and Metrics Portals at CESGA
ipv6 migration at cesga for the infrastructure should be completed
There are no reason for the portals for being not compliant, but official tests were not performed. Ok to participate to a testbed if created within EGI.
GGUS
In principle is ok, more investigation with network experts are needed
Accounting
- clients have had their code checked within EMI activities.
- repository: unknown. RAL site which hosts is not yet supporting IPv6, more details after investigation with the experts
Both have dependency on broker network.
GOCDB
- Need to add new IPv6 fields to the Site and Service entities for rendering in the PI.
- GOCDB itself is not IPv6 capable at the moment, more details after investigation with
the experts
SAM
Probes: it’s up to EMI, we should investigate with them.
SAM side: apache is ipv6 compliant, nagios is compliant, strong dependence with messaging see next point.
Messaging
Message broker services are not compliant, both at an infrastructure level and at a software level. Software compliance should be requested to EMI, infrastructure can be fixed.
Ops Portal
The sw should compatible, but no official tests were made on the topic.
